The CandidPro Treatment Process
Consultation & Treatment Planning: Hardin and our team will complete a comprehensive examination of your teeth and gums, including taking X-rays, to determine whether you’re a good candidate for CandidPro aligner therapy in Plano. If so, we’ll partner with a Candid-Pro licensed orthodontist to create a customized treatment plan for you.
Start Your Treatment: After CandidPro creates and ships your customized aligners, we’ll give you all the instructions you need to start your journey, including showing you how to put in and take out your trays, as well as how to clean them.
Routine Check-Ins: You’ll use CandidPro’s all-digital, AI-powered smartphone app called ProMonitoring to track your results and check in with Dr. Hardin throughout your treatment.
Maintaining Your Results: Finally, after your treatment plan is finished, our team will fit you for a clear, low-profile retainer you will wear to help maintain your hard-earned results.

Wearing Your Trays
In order to stay on-track with your treatment plan, you need to wear your CandidPro aligners for 20+ hours a day. The best way to make this happen each and every day is by finding a schedule that works and sticking to it. In the beginning, it’s helpful to use the stopwatch on your phone as a guide so you can see how close or far you are from the goal. With time, however, it will be second-nature.
Cleaning Your Aligners
Keeping your CandidPro aligners clean does require some work. The good news is that you only need a couple of items, and it will only require a few minutes of your time! The first habit we recommend adopting is rinsing your trays with clean, cool water when you take them out. Additionally, you should use a damp, soft-bristled toothbrush to remove saliva, food particles, plaque, and other debris from their surface after each meal.
Note: Some patients are allowed to use mild dishwashing liquid as well, but don’t just use any household cleaner. In fact, even toothpaste and mouthwash aren’t recommended for clear aligners!
Eating & Drinking
Fortunately, eating and drinking with CandidPro is also really easy. That’s because there’s only one rule: take your aligners off beforehand. Make sure you don’t leave them out on the counter or wrap them in a napkin either. This is one of the most common ways they get misplaced (more on that in the next section). Instead, store your trays somewhere safe, brush your teeth when you’re done eating, and put them back on shortly after.

Does Dental Insurance Cover Clear Aligners?
Depending on your plan, dental insurance may offer coverage for clear aligners. Typically, when available, most insurers will agree to pay up to 50% of the total cost. The catch, however, is that not all insurance policies contain clauses for orthodontic treatment. In many cases, you’ll need to purchase a supplemental plan. Even then, you’ll need to make sure that it doesn’t contain stipulations that could keep you from seeking treatment.

How long does CandidPro treatment take?
If you’re like most patients, you want straight teeth and a beautiful smile as quickly as possible. However, there’s no one-size-fits-all treatment plan for clear aligner therapy. Your unique journey will depend on your oral anatomy and how well you keep up with wearing your aligners. Complex cases can usually take a year or more, while less extensive cases can usually completed in less time.
Does CandidPro aligner therapy hurt?
When it comes to just about any dental treatment, including braces, patients are worried about discomfort. So, if you’ve been hesitant to commit to CandidPro because you’re concerned that it will hurt, you’re not alone. Turns out, you also don’t have anything to worry about! That’s because the aligners are completely free of metal and custom-made to fit your mouth perfectly. Of course, some temporary soreness from time to time is expected since your teeth are being moved into completely new positions, but even that can be alleviated with a few simple steps (i.e., sipping on cool water, avoiding crunchy foods, taking OTC pain medication).
Can you eat whatever you want with CandidPro aligners?
You cannot eat anything while your CandidPro aligners are in. Outside of that, however, the rules around food are pretty lax because the trays are removable! As a result, you don’t have to worry about your braces breaking under the pressure of whole apples, tortilla chips, carrots, and other crunchy foods. All we ask as your dental team is that you keep sugary foods and drinks to a minimum to reduce your risk of developing tooth decay.
How do I clean my CandidPro aligners?
When you first get your aligners, they will be perfectly clear. To keep them that way, you need to take good care of them. That includes consistently rinsing them with water when you take them off and using a soft-bristled toothbrush to clean them before you put them back in your mouth. Some patients also like using toothpaste, but the abrasive ingredients can make the aligners look dull. If you’re having trouble keeping your trays clean, you can also talk to us about using a mild, clear dishwashing liquid too.
